Security and Privacy Considerations in Collaborative Platforms

Security and privacy are vital aspects of collaborative course development platforms, especially within online learning environments. Ensuring that sensitive course content, instructor data, and learner information are protected is paramount. Platforms must implement robust security measures, such as encryption, to safeguard data both in transit and at rest.

Key security features to consider include user authentication protocols, access controls, and activity logging. These elements help prevent unauthorized access and facilitate tracking of changes made during course creation. Additionally, compliance with data protection regulations, such as GDPR or FERPA, is essential to maintain legal standards.

To further secure collaborative environments, platforms should offer customizable privacy settings, enabling course creators to control who can view or edit content. Regular security audits and software updates also help mitigate potential vulnerabilities. Ultimately, choosing a platform with comprehensive security and privacy measures ensures safe, reliable collaboration, fostering trust among all users involved in online course creation.

Evaluating and Choosing the Right Collaborative Platform for Your Needs

When evaluating collaborative course development platforms, it is important to consider their core functionalities and compatibility with your team’s workflow. Assess features such as real-time editing, version control, communication tools, and integration capabilities with other educational technologies. These aspects directly influence the effectiveness of collaborative efforts in course creation.

Next, examine the platform’s ease of use and accessibility. A user-friendly interface minimizes onboarding time and promotes widespread adoption among team members, while accessibility ensures all contributors can participate regardless of device or location. Compatibility with various devices and browsers is also vital for seamless collaboration.

Finally, prioritize security and data privacy measures. Ensure the platform complies with relevant data protection standards and offers robust access controls. Trustworthy platforms safeguard sensitive content and personal information, which is essential for maintaining confidentiality during the development process. Carefully comparing these factors helps identify the most suitable collaborative course development platform tailored to your needs.
